										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">The possibility of restoring kidney function largely depends on the type and stage of the disease. In cases of acute kidney disease, an aggressive treatment can sometimes reverse the damage, allowing the kidneys to recover fully or partially. </span></p>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">Treatment may include intravenous fluids, medications to address underlying causes, and supportive care.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">On the other hand, chronic kidney disease presents a different challenge. The condition is usually not reversible, but the progression of the disease can often be slowed, and quality of life can be maintained with appropriate treatment. </span></p>

<h2><b>Does Your Dog Need Joint Supplements?</b></h2>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">Recognizing the signs of joint pain in your dog can be a challenge, but it&#8217;s a crucial step towards their well-being. Early detection of these signs, such as common behavioral changes and limitations, can empower you to take proactive steps to address their pain. </span></p>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">Some of the critical signs to watch for are the following:</span></p>
<ul>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Difficulty Getting Up: </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">Does your dog seem stiff or hesitant when rising from a nap or after extended rest periods? This can be a sign of joint pain that makes it uncomfortable for them to put weight on their legs.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Stiffness: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> Does your dog seem less flexible or appear to move with a reduced range of motion? This stiffness might be particularly noticeable after exercise or playtime.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Limping: </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">A limp is a more obvious sign of pain and can affect one or more legs. The severity of the limp can vary depending on the underlying cause of the joint pain.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Reluctance to Play or Exercise: </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">If your dog used to love chasing squirrels or playing fetch but now seems less interested in activities they once enjoyed, it could be due to joint pain. This discomfort can significantly impact their quality of life, making movement uncomfortable and less enjoyable.</span><b> </b></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Stair Avoidance: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> Does your dog avoid climbing stairs or struggle to get on the couch? This can signify pain, especially in the hips or knees.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Licking or Chewing at Joints: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> If your dog excessively licks or chews at a particular joint, it could be a sign of pain or inflammation in that area.</span></li>
</ul>
<h3><strong>Factors that can increase your dog&#8217;s risk</strong></h3>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">Of course, it&#8217;s also important to note that some dog breeds are more prone to developing joint problems than others, with multiple factors that can increase your dog&#8217;s risk:</span></p>
<ul>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Age</b><span style="font-weight: 400;">: As dogs age, the cartilage in their joints naturally breaks down, leading to conditions like osteoarthritis.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Breed Size: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> Large dog breeds tend to put more stress on their joints, making them more susceptible to joint pain.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Previous Injuries: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> Injuries like ligament tears or fractures can increase the risk of future joint problems.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Weight: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> Carrying excess weight puts extra strain on joints, accelerating wear and tear.</span></li>
</ul>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">As a responsible dog owner, your role in observing and reporting any of these signs in your dog is crucial. If you notice any of these signs, it&#8217;s essential to consult your veterinarian promptly. They can provide a proper diagnosis, determine the underlying cause of the pain, and develop a treatment plan that may include joint supplements and other strategies.</span></p>
<h2><b>How Can Joint Supplements Help Manage Dog Pain?</b></h2>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">While we can&#8217;t guarantee that joint supplements are a panacea, they can be a valuable tool in managing your dog&#8217;s joint pain and promoting overall joint health, offering a sense of relief and comfort. </span></p>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">These supplements typically contain a combination of ingredients that target different aspects of joint function.</span></p>
<ul>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Glucosamine and Chondroitin: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> The building blocks of healthy cartilage; the spongy tissue cushions the bones within a joint. </span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>MSM (Methylsulfonylmethane): </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">This naturally occurring sulfur compound has anti-inflammatory properties that may help reduce joint pain and swelling.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Hyaluronic Acid: </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">This substance acts like a lubricant within the joint, promoting smoother movement and reducing friction.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Omega-3 Fatty Acids: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> These essential fatty acids are anti-inflammatory and may help manage joint pain and stiffness.</span></li>
</ul>
<h3><strong>Benefits for dogs with joint pain</strong></h3>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">While the exact mechanisms of action for these ingredients are still being researched, studies suggest that joint supplements can offer several benefits for dogs with joint pain, including:</span></p>
<ul>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Reduced inflammation: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> These supplements may help alleviate pain and discomfort by targeting inflammation within the joint.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Improved joint lubrication: </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">Certain ingredients, like hyaluronic acid, can help lubricate joints, promoting smoother movement and reducing stiffness.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Supported cartilage health: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> Glucosamine and chondroitin may help support cartilage&#8217;s health and resilience, potentially slowing its breakdown.</span></li>
</ul>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">Joint supplements can play a significant role in improving your dog&#8217;s overall mobility and quality of life. By addressing pain, inflammation, and stiffness, these supplements can enhance your dog&#8217;s comfort and well-being.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">It&#8217;s important to remember that joint supplements may take several weeks to show noticeable effects. Consistency is vital, so follow the recommended dosage and administration schedule.</span></p>

<h2><b>Recognizing the Signs of Joint Issues in Dogs</b></h2>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">We often look at our dogs as they lie peacefully next to us, not knowing what exactly is happening to their mind and body. But, dogs can&#8217;t always tell us they&#8217;re in pain, so it&#8217;s important to be aware of the signs of joint problems. </span></p>
<p><a href="https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pmc/articles/PMC7915998/"><span style="font-weight: 400;">Early diagnostics</span></a><span style="font-weight: 400;"> and prevention via supplements can be critical for the well-being of your dog. Here are some common indicators to watch for:</span></p>
<ul>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Limping or stiffness: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> The classic sign of joint pain, especially after exercise or rest.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Difficulty rising: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> Notice if your dog struggles to get up from a lying position or has trouble climbing stairs.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Reduced activity level: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> Is your once playful pup less interested in walks or playtime?</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Whining or yelping: </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">Vocalization can be a sign of pain, especially when touched in a certain area.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Reluctance to jump: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> Does your dog hesitate to jump on furniture or into the car?</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Licking or chewing at joints: </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">Pay attention to excessive licking or chewing at paws or specific areas.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Visible swelling or deformity: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> In some cases, you may see noticeable swelling or even deformity around the joints.</span></li>
</ul>
<h2><b>Why Choose Joint Supplements for Dogs?</b></h2>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">As inquisitive creatures by nature, dogs are one of the most active beings around. But this comes with a price. </span></p>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">Daily wear and tear, breed predisposition, and activity level can all contribute to joint problems in dogs. Over time, cartilage, the cushioning material between bones, can break down, leading to pain and inflammation.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">When that day comes, joint supplements can help significantly by providing some of the most potent ingredients that support healthy joints in dogs:</span></p>
<ul>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Glucosamine and Chondroitin: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> These building blocks of cartilage help the dog&#8217;s body repair and maintain healthy cartilage tissue.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>MSM (Methylsulfonylmethane): </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">This natural compound has anti-inflammatory properties that can help reduce pain and stiffness.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Omega-3 Fatty Acids: </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">These essential fatty acids have </span><a href="https://www.simonvetsurgical.com/news/benefits-omega-3-fatty-acids-dogs-with-osteoarthritis"><span style="font-weight: 400;">well-documented benefits</span></a><span style="font-weight: 400;"> for reducing inflammation and promoting joint lubrication.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Hyaluronic Acid: </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">This naturally occurring molecule acts as a lubricant in joints, promoting smoother movements.</span></li>
</ul>

<h2><b>The Importance of Early Diagnosis and Prevention</b></h2>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">Just like with any health concern, early detection and preventative interventions are critical for managing joint problems in dogs. Here&#8217;s why:</span></p>
<ul>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Slows Disease Progression: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> Early diagnosis allows the treatment to begin before significant damage occurs. This can slow the progression of joint diseases like osteoarthritis and prevent them from becoming debilitating.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Improves Treatment Outcomes: </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">Early intervention with pain management, weight control, and joint supplements can be more effective in managing pain and improving your dog&#8217;s quality of life.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Reduces Long-Term Costs:</b><span style="font-weight: 400;"> Early action can help prevent the need for more expensive treatments down the line, such as surgery or long-term pain medication.</span></li>
<li style="font-weight: 400;" aria-level="1"><b>Maintains Mobility and Activity Level: </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">By addressing joint issues early, you can help your dog stay active and maintain a good quality of life for longer.</span></li>
</ul>
<p><span style="font-weight: 400;">In addition to joint supplements and early diagnosis, there are also other activities you can do to help your dog maintain healthy joints:</span></p>
<p><b>Massage Therapy &#8211; </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">Before attempting any physical therapy for your dog, consult with a certified canine massage therapist to learn the proper techniques. Massage can be a soothing and effective way to promote circulation, improve flexibility, alleviate joint discomfort, and enhance overall well-being. </span></p>
<p><b>Regular Exercise &#8211; </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">Gentle exercise helps keep joints lubricated and muscles strong, especially if you’re taking care of a larger dog needing to shed a few pounds. Activities like leash walks, fetch games, doggy yoga, or swimming can all help, provided they&#8217;re appropriate for your dog&#8217;s fitness level.</span></p>
<p><b>Supportive Dog Bed &#8211; </b><span style="font-weight: 400;">Creating a comfortable sleeping and resting area for your dog is essential for their joint health. Invest in a quality dog bed that provides adequate support and cushioning for their joints.</span></p>
